TRAVEL ALERTS FOR HAYWOOD COUNTY

latest travel alerts

  1. Home
  2. Travel Alerts

Travel information

All visitors should stay aware and be prepared for road closures, power outages, and extremely cold temperatures.

Please visit ReadyHaywood.com for important updates and safety information.

Last updated: 01/23/2026

Visit ReadyHaywood.com
general alerts
  • Significant icing, including compacted sleet and snow, are expected. Total snow and sleet accumulations up to two inches and ice accumulations around one inch are possible in some areas. Winds gusts may reach 40 mph.
    It is extremely dangerous to travel on ice-covered roadways. During the storm, stay off the roadways whenever possible. Hazardous conditions may last through Monday.

    Power outages are likely due to the weight of the ice and snow on tree limbs and power lines.

blue ridge parkway
  • The Parkway is not open for foot or vehicle traffic while winter weather persists.
    To view road status by milepost, visit https://www.nps.gov/blri/planyourvisit/roadclosures.htm.
